What the Data Says About Virginia Commonwealth University
The federal enforcement record for Virginia Commonwealth University in Richmond, VA includes 14 OSHA inspections and 17 violations, translating to 1.21 violations per inspection. Of those violations, 10 (58.8%) were classified as serious, 0 (0.0%) as willful, and 0 (0.0%) as repeat. Serious violations denote hazards likely to cause death or serious physical harm; willful and repeat categories indicate intentional disregard or recurrence of previously cited hazards.
No OSHA penalty has been assessed against Virginia Commonwealth University to date. The Administrative & Waste Services sector average runs $3,722 per employer. The Wage and Hour Division added 1 case producing $0 in back wages owed to an undisclosed number of workers.
Inspection activity spans from 2011-03-09 to 2018-09-25, a window of roughly 8 years.
